How Kennedy Agyapong Plans To Develop The Central Region When Elected As President
NPP flagbearer hopeful, Kennedy Agyapong, who doubles as the MP for Assin Central constituency, has revealed how he plans to develop the central region of Ghana when elected as the president of Ghana.
In his recent interview on Castle FM in Cape Coast, Kennedy Agyapong, expressed his unwavering commitment to usher an industrial revolution into Ghana’s Central Region if given the opportunity in the 2024 elections.
He highlighted the need for the region to experience substantial development, particularly in tourism, aiming to revamp attractions like the Kakum Forest to prolong tourists’ stays.

Agyapong plans to enhance tourist safety, fortifying Kakum Forest with an electric fence and providing resources for animal inhabitants. He also envisions fixing roads and introducing protective measures for tourists against potential animal encounters.
Emphasizing his business acumen, Agyapong proposed leveraging the region’s resources, such as fertile lands and palm plantations, to create wealth and generate employment opportunities for the youth. His vision encompasses not leaving out the fisher folks and emphasizes the necessity for improved highways to facilitate regional progress.
Agyapong urged delegates to choose wisely in the upcoming NPP Presidential Elections, highlighting his track record of contributions to the region and the party’s successes in elections, vowing to lead an industrial transformation in the Central Region if entrusted with the responsibility.
“Why would tourists drive 2-3 hours back to Accra after visiting the famous Kakum Forest for a brief moment? This is because we don’t do the things that will attract these tourists to stay when they come to the region” he said.
“I will also make sure the road leading to the tourist sites is fixed and provide armoured trucks to transport tourists in the forest without any attack from the animals.
“Do you know the number of people that will get jobs? Our lands are very fertile and we don’t have factories in the region. We are even underutilizing the palm plantation we have in the region because more can be derived from the palm we produce,” he continued.
Kennedy Ohene Agyapong will contest for the flagbearership slot of the NPP along with three other contenders including Vice president Dr Mahamudu Bawumia, Dr Owusu Afriyie Akoto, and Francis Addai-Nimoh.
The New Patriotic Party (NPP) has slated November 4, 2023, to elect a successor to President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o as leader of the party. Kennedy Agyapong and Dr Mahamudu Bawumia are the key favorites to win the election on November, 4, 2023.
